ABB 3BHE022291R0101 Fail-Safe Communications I/O Module: Fault Protection and Critical Industrial Field Reliability
The ABB 3BHE022291R0101 (part number PC D230 A) is a high-integrity Communications I/O Module engineered for the ABB AC800PEC Power Electronics Controller platform — one of ABB’s most demanding control architectures deployed in high-power drive systems, excitation control, and safety-critical industrial automation. Designed to sustain continuous, uninterrupted signal exchange between the controller core and field devices, this module is a cornerstone component in control cabinets where communication failure is not an option.
In industrial environments where electromagnetic interference, voltage transients, thermal cycling, and mechanical vibration are constant threats, the 3BHE022291R0101 delivers the signal integrity and fault tolerance required to keep critical loops operational. Whether installed in a power generation excitation cabinet, a high-power variable frequency drive enclosure, or a safety interlock panel, this module is built to maintain deterministic I/O communication under conditions that would compromise lesser components.

Control Cabinet Protection Strategy
The 3BHE022291R0101 does not operate in isolation — its reliability is amplified when deployed as part of a coordinated control cabinet protection strategy. In AC800PEC-based systems, the communications I/O module works in close coordination with the ABB SDCS-CON-4 control board, which manages the core drive logic and relies on stable I/O communication to execute fault-safe responses. Any signal disruption at the I/O layer propagates directly to drive behavior, making the integrity of this module mission-critical.
For power supply stability within the same cabinet, the ABB SDCS-POW-4 power supply board provides the regulated DC rails that feed the control electronics. Pairing it with the 3BHE022291R0101 ensures that I/O communication is not compromised by internal power fluctuations or surge events. In installations where surge protection is a concern — particularly in substations or outdoor switchgear environments — supplementary surge protective devices (SPDs) rated for 24 VDC control circuits are recommended at the cabinet entry point.
For systems requiring expanded I/O capacity or redundant communication paths, the ABB CI854A PROFIBUS DP communication interface module is commonly deployed alongside AC800PEC controllers to extend fieldbus connectivity to distributed I/O racks and field instruments. In safety interlock architectures, the ABB AI810 analog input module and ABB DO810 digital output module are frequently integrated into the same control loop, with the 3BHE022291R0101 serving as the communications backbone that ensures all I/O transactions are executed with deterministic timing and fault detection.
In high-vibration or thermally stressed environments — such as steel mill drive rooms or offshore platform motor control centers — cabinet thermal management components including forced-air cooling units and thermal monitoring relays are essential companions to the 3BHE022291R0101, preventing the thermal drift that can degrade communication signal margins over time.
Critical Industrial Safety Applications
Power Generation & Excitation Control: In thermal and hydroelectric power plants, the AC800PEC platform with the 3BHE022291R0101 is deployed in generator excitation control systems. The module maintains real-time communication between the excitation controller and field measurement I/O, ensuring that reactive power regulation and fault ride-through functions operate without communication-induced delays. A communication failure in this context can trigger unplanned generator trips — the 3BHE022291R0101’s fault-tolerant design directly mitigates this risk.
Petrochemical & Refinery Automation: In continuous process plants where safety instrumented systems (SIS) and basic process control systems (BPCS) share cabinet infrastructure, the integrity of every I/O communication link is subject to functional safety audits. The 3BHE022291R0101’s EMI-hardened design and deterministic communication behavior make it suitable for deployment in zones where variable speed drives and high-current switching equipment create persistent electromagnetic noise floors.
Mining & Mineral Processing: Conveyor drive systems, crusher motor controls, and hoist drives in underground and open-pit mining operations demand components that can withstand dust ingress, humidity, and mechanical shock. The 3BHE022291R0101, as part of the AC800PEC ecosystem, supports the high-availability drive control required to prevent unplanned conveyor stoppages that result in production loss and safety incidents.
Port & Heavy Lifting Equipment: Ship-to-shore cranes, rubber-tyred gantry cranes, and bulk material handling systems rely on precise torque and speed control delivered through AC800PEC-based drive systems. The communications I/O module ensures that load feedback signals, brake control outputs, and safety interlock states are transmitted without latency or data corruption — critical for preventing load drop incidents.
Water & Wastewater Treatment: Pump station variable speed drives and blower control systems in water treatment facilities operate in high-humidity, chemically aggressive environments. The 3BHE022291R0101 supports reliable I/O communication in these conditions, reducing the risk of pump runaway, dry-run damage, or overflow events caused by control signal loss.
Metallurgy & Steel Production: Rolling mill drives, ladle furnace electrode regulators, and continuous casting machine drives represent some of the most demanding applications for industrial control hardware. In these environments, the 3BHE022291R0101 must maintain communication integrity despite extreme thermal gradients, high-frequency switching noise from thyristor converters, and mechanical vibration from rolling stands — conditions it is specifically engineered to withstand.
